I set up Bluetooth tethering on my phone with name "Searle". I boot my Ubuntu laptop. "Searle" is shown in the network indicator menu. After I connect "nm-applet" is shown. After I disconnect "_Configure VPN..." is shown. At other times I have seen the words "separator", "Label Empty" and I have also een undisplayable characters. network-manager 0.9.8.0-0ubuntu6 on machine recently upgraded to Ubuntu 13.04.
